The effects of super-plastic pre-treatment (SPPT) and cold rolling before aging on the microstructure and mechanical properties of the 7A04 and 2024 Al alloys were investigated by means of optical microscope, mechanical tensile test, EBSD analyse, SEM and TEM observations. The relations of the microstructure and mechanical properties were discussed also. The conclusion can be drawn as the following:1. The average grains size of 7A04 alloy by SPPT is Hum, however that by conventional treatment(CT) is 30μm. The SPPT improves the ultimate tensile strength by 3.5%, and elongation to failure by 25.7% . The average size of grains by SPPT is smaller than one by CT. The enhancement in plasticity is attributed to refinement of grains.2. 7A04 alloy obtains the optimal combination of strength and ductility in such solid solution and recrystallize treatment: 470℃ ×5min+480℃× 12min, the contradiction on dissolution of overageing phases and growth of new grains was settled also by it. The tensile strength is 585MPa and elongation to failure is 17.6%.3. As the overaging temperature in the SPPT increasing, the strength of 2024 alloy also improving. When the over-aging temperature obtains 350℃,the alloy performance is superior. There are two peaks in the curve of tensile properties, the first peak appears when the ageing time is 40min. When the aging time is 120min, the second peak appears, at the moment the main second phase is S'.4. The performance of 7A04 alloy by cold rolling before aging is degenerated when compared with 2024 alloy, it is mainly because the coarsening of grain of 7A04 alloy in the dislocation is severer than 2024 alloy, so the properties of 2024 alloy is predominant.
